Campus-wide rollout

View Project

HoRST 3D

Rebuilt HoRST 3D for Hochschule der Medien Stuttgart as a campus navigation PWA with an interactive 3D model, offline support, kiosk deployment, and hundreds of daily users after the full rollout.

  • Relaunched the product from scratch in 2023 together with two students to improve performance, stability, maintainability, and documentation across mobile, desktop, and kiosk use cases.
  • Designed the product around practical campus orientation, including buildings, rooms, and facilities inside an interactive 3D model with offline support.
  • HoRST 3D was selected for a special MediaNight presentation to university leadership and international guests before replacing the legacy system campus-wide.

Self-Service Server Products

  • Built Sparkane, a fully automated browser-based platform for launching private Minecraft challenge servers for players with no manual setup, provisioning more than 8,000 servers per month.
  • Built setupmc.com, which supports more than 1,800 active Minecraft server administrators monthly with a real-time Docker Compose configurator and paid backup guidance.
  • Focused on removing setup and operations friction while keeping the products scalable and cost-efficient in production.
